$20 for a restore disk is not bad considering it has your OS and drivers, unless it is windows ME. google " e-machines lottery " with out the quotes, that is a web site of emachines drivers. E-machines has a tech ? sure would not want that I worked for e-machines on my resume. you may have to look at the chip set , audio chip set, lan etc.
 
more than likely you will yield more results for mainboard drivers, if you open up the pc and find a make or model number for the mainboard. My eMachines box is a W2785 (Athlon 2700+) from 2003, and the mobo is an FIC AM39L... this sounded promising, until I found out that FIC does not support it! Seems to be custom-made for eMachines, as FIC's websites have no info at all on it. I have to get my chipset drivers from VIA, sound drivers from Realtek, etc, ...and I can forget about BIOS upgrades! (the BIOS I have has less than half the items mentioned in the motherboard manual)
Two other names for eMachines motherboards are Anaheim and Imperial. There were a lot more but some eMachines sites are now history.
Tom
PS: Just found out today when digging around the FIC website that my AM39L is really an FIC K7M-400 and the only thing that's "eMachines" about it is the custom BIOS! Now I'm wondering if I can use the FIC BIOS upgrade or not in order to enable all the options shown in the motherboard manual!
